Output 5307a37a41ac896c577d753f3904d22b13d2141d8440f9e78e3784e17eea8cc8:2

value
1422406
script pubkey
OP_0 OP_PUSHBYTES_20 58f3c31d2b5606146aaaa3fee6373c6412cbbe59
address
tb1qtreux8ft2crpg64250lwvdeuvsfvh0jecw7s63
transaction
5307a37a41ac896c577d753f3904d22b13d2141d8440f9e78e3784e17eea8cc8